假设我有这样的密码: private final ExecutorService executor;
executor.execute(() -> {/* Do important task */});}
如果不是在构造函数中传递ThreadPoolExecutor,而是使用ForkJoinPool,我
我想使用Java fork join来解决递归问题,但我不想为每个递归步骤显式地创建一个新的任务实例。原因是太多的任务等同于太多的对象,它们在几分钟的处理后填满了我的内存。我在Java 6中有以下解决方案,但是有更好的Java 7实现吗?final static AtomicInteger max = new AtomicInteger(10); // max parallel tasks
final stati